Savannah Guthrie, Mike Feldman are married, expecting their first child together

Savannah Guthrie announced her engagement to communications strategist Mike Feldman on The Today Show in May 2013, so it was only fitting for her to use the same platform to break a couple of more surprising news to her supporters: she was married last weekend and she is pregnant.

The 42-year-old Today co-anchor has been keeping her romance to Feldman close to her vest and, as she explained hours ago on the show, she wanted her wedding day to be a truly special moment for her, Mike, and their families and friends.

So, they did their best to keep the details of the wedding under wraps and, last weekend, headed out to the desert, at a location outside her hometown of Tucson, Arizona, with a handful of people close to both, and tied the knot.

At the ceremony, during a speech held by the newlyweds, after the music from the NBC News Special Report segment played, Savannah took the microphone and broke the news that she and Mike would be soon becoming parents.

“We are so excited, overjoyed and feel so blessed,” she told her fellow Today anchors. “It's funny, 'cause we set the wedding date, I bought my dress, and then I found out. So I've been doing a little praying that I would fit in it, and it all worked out.”

“I feel great, and actually I'm so happy to tell the world. Because I can't suck in this gut anymore,” she continued.

She’s also relieved to be finally addressing rumors and comments coming from The Today viewers, who have been telling her for weeks that she looked “a little pregnant.”

Savannah says that her and Mike’s baby will be born in late summer, adding that they’re absolutely buzzing with happiness, both because of the wedding and at the prospect of becoming parents so soon.

When she announced the engagement last May, Guthrie didn’t as much as hint at a possible wedding date, so chances are the plan was from the start to keep it a secret to ensure that their special moment isn’t ruined by too much attention from the paparazzi. This is becoming standard practice with celebrities looking to keep out of the first pages of the tabloids and to exercise some control over their private life.
